Due to tight household budgets and financial problems caused by the credit crunch, many consumers are looking to curb their non-essential spending. Many individuals are thought to choose health insurance as one form of protection that they could do without, according to recent studies.
However, strong BUPA sales and reports that private medical insurance takeup in the UK now exceeds seven million contradict this finding. Consumers looking for good quality healthcare on the national health service will be glad to hear that NHS queues are dropping, officially at least.
Whether the National Health Service will remain a free resource remains to be seen, and currently some life saving drugs are not available on the health service.
